      DashrenderD

      FYI, using SQRL doesn't mean that a website won't still want a second way to verify someone's identity, etc.

      Many of the doubters look at websites that use an email address as a logon name. These websites are getting a two for one benefit. SQRL does not get this. If the site wants to provide away to 'reset the user's password,' the site will need to find another way to verify identity, i.e. an email address, questions and answer, text message - whatever they want to use.

      DashrenderD

      @thecreativeone91 said:

      I've done something similar with ring groups. Have a set of extensions that are where most phone calls are answered ring says 2-3 times and then if the call isn't taken in that time it fails over to another set of ring groups for other people to answer. There's probably a better way of doing it though.

      This is how it works right now with some of our other groups, and it's not working for us.

      I would love a smart queue - when breaching 5 people in queue, add person 1, if I'm still over 5, add person two, if I'm still over 5, add person three, etc. Then when each of those persons hangup, the system asks, are there still more than 5 calls in that queue, if yes, transfer one to this now open line, if not, remove them from the queue.
